Rich:editor 4.1 customizavel em uma custom tag para JSF 2.0 , como fazer?

Olá pessoal do forum, blz?
estou fazendo um componente rich:editor do richfaces 4 em que eu possa delimitar um parametro “mode”, onde eu escolha o modelo de botoes que deverão aparecer, estou usando um <f:facet /> com as duas interfaces do componente mas não sei como “jogar” p atributo mode dentro desse facet para ser realizada a mudança, abaixo deixo o código para melhor intendimento.

componente satangoss:editor

[code]cc:interface
<cc:atribute name=“mode” />
</cc:interface>

cc:implementation

<rich:editor id="#{id}" value="#{value}" lang="pt-br">
			<f:facet name="config">
                toolbar: '#{cc.attrs.mode}',
                startupFocus: true,
                toolbar_custom:
                    [                    
                        { name: 'document', items : [ 'Source','-','DocProps','Preview','Print','-','Templates' ] },                      	                        	                        	                        	
                    	{ name: 'insert', items : [ 'Table','HorizontalRule','SpecialChar'] },
                    	{ name: 'styles', items : [ 'Format' ] },
                    	{ name: 'basicstyles', items : [ 'Bold','Italic','-','RemoveFormat' ] },
                    	{ name: 'paragraph', items : [ 'NumberedList','BulletedList','-','Outdent','Indent','-','JustifyLeft','JustifyCenter','JustifyRight','JustifyBlock','-' ] },                        	
                    	{ name: 'tools', items : [ 'Maximize' ] }
                    ],
                toolbar_full:
                    [                        	                        	                        	
                    	{ name: 'insert', items : [ 'Image','Table','HorizontalRule','SpecialChar','PageBreak'] },
                    	{ name: 'styles', items : [ 'Styles','Format' ] },
                    	{ name: 'basicstyles', items : [ 'Bold','Italic','Strike','-','RemoveFormat' ] },
                    	{ name: 'paragraph', items : [ 'NumberedList','BulletedList','-','Outdent','Indent','-','Blockquote','-','JustifyLeft','JustifyCenter','JustifyRight','JustifyBlock' ] },
                    	{ name: 'links', items : [ 'Link','Unlink','Anchor' ] },
                    	{ name: 'tools', items : [ 'Maximize' ] }
                    ]                        
           		</f:facet>
		</rich:editor>

</cc:implementation>[/code]

e na pagina utililizo assim:

  <satangoss:editor id="id111" label="pae:editor2" value="#{var['editor2']}" required="true" mode="custom"/>

O ploblema é que não está sendo pego o valor do cc.attrs.mode no facet, alguem sabe como posso resolver esso problema?